Understanding Geosynthetic Clay Liners

Geosynthetic Clay Liners (GCLs) consist of clay that is sandwiched between two layers of geotextile or geomembrane. This design allows for effective waterproofing and is commonly used in landfills, embankments, and waste containment systems. Their unique properties make them a preferred choice for many projects.

Enhanced Leachate Control

According to Dr. Emily Carter, a leading environmental engineer, "One of the most significant benefits of using Geosynthetic Clay Liners is their ability to effectively control leachate. This is critical in landfill applications, where preventing the escape of harmful substances into the ground is essential." GCLs act as barriers that minimize the movement of liquids, which helps protect surrounding ecosystems.

Cost-Effectiveness

Expert in construction materials, John Richards, emphasizes the financial advantages: "When considering the overall project costs, GCLs are often more economical than traditional clay liners. Their ease of installation and reduced need for additional materials translate into lower labor and operational costs." This cost-effectiveness makes GCLs an attractive option for budget-conscious projects.

Quick and Easy Installation

Another advantage highlighted by civil engineer Sarah Thompson is the quick installation process associated with Geosynthetic Clay Liners. "With GCLs, the installation time is significantly reduced because they are lightweight and flexible. This translates to fewer labor hours and quicker project completion times," she explains. The efficiency of using GCLs can improve project timelines considerably.
